Let's tackle an important topic: your marketing investment. Notice we didn't say marketing budget. Just like the roof over your location and the sign out front, marketing is an investment in attracting new customers. Don't think of your spend here as a cost to your business - it truly is the most important investment you can make in growing profits. Everything you do - from your website, to signage in your location, traditional and digital advertising - it's all marketing. So it's important to invest the right amount to get the results you need to meet or beat your business goals. Setting goals for your bottom line is the place to start. How are sales today? Where do you want them to be this quarter, this year? List your products and services and the margins you earn for each sale, and put it in writing. How aggressive do you want to be?
